Plagiarism Detection

The author(s) is (are) responsible for the content and citations of all references in the article; therefore, plagiarism is strictly prohibited. Articles identified with a plagiarism percentage greater than 20% will not be considered for the review process, and the author(s) will be penalized: they will not be allowed to publish in the Journal for two years, and their Institution will be notified.

The software used for plagiarism detection is Turnitin, where a similarity percentage below 20% is required in order not to be rejected.
